Which document is essential for the coordination of resources during an incident?

Explanation:
The Situational Report (SitRep) is a critical document for the coordination of resources during an incident because it provides a comprehensive overview of the current status of the situation. This report includes key information such as the nature of the incident, the resources that are available, the status of operations, and any urgent needs that have arisen. By consolidating all pertinent details into one document, it allows decision-makers and responders to assess the situation effectively, make informed decisions, and allocate resources efficiently. Furthermore, the SitRep is typically updated regularly and shared among various departments and agencies involved in the response, fostering collaboration and ensuring that all parties have access to the same information. This helps in maintaining a unified command structure, which is vital for effective communication and coordination during emergencies. Other options, such as the Tactical Plan and Emergency Response Guide, may serve important roles in specific aspects of the incident response but do not encompass the comprehensive situational overview and resource coordination that the SitRep provides. The Resource Allocation Matrix, while useful for detailing specific resources, lacks the real-time situational context necessary for optimal resource coordination.
